Array.from(arr)与[...arr]究竟有何本质区别?
- 内容介绍
- 文章标签
- 相关推荐
本文共计1456个文字,预计阅读时间需要6分钟。
在开头:+ 在正文开始之前,我们先说明一下类数组(类数组估计大家一定不会陌生)的特点: 1. 有索引 2. 有长度 3. 是一个对象 4. 能被迭代特点说明: 对于类数组的特征,前三个我就不详细说明了。
写在开头:
在正文开始之前我们先说明一下类数组(估计大家一定不会陌生)
类数组的特点
1.有索引
2.有长度
3.是个对象
4.能被迭代
特点说明:对于类数组的特点前三个我就不做说明了哈,主要就是最后一个,能被迭代需要具备什么呢?由图我们可以看出有一个[Symbol.iterator]属性指向该对象的默认迭代器方法。
本文共计1456个文字,预计阅读时间需要6分钟。
在开头:+ 在正文开始之前,我们先说明一下类数组(类数组估计大家一定不会陌生)的特点: 1. 有索引 2. 有长度 3. 是一个对象 4. 能被迭代特点说明: 对于类数组的特征,前三个我就不详细说明了。
写在开头:
在正文开始之前我们先说明一下类数组(估计大家一定不会陌生)
类数组的特点
1.有索引
2.有长度
3.是个对象
4.能被迭代
特点说明:对于类数组的特点前三个我就不做说明了哈,主要就是最后一个,能被迭代需要具备什么呢?由图我们可以看出有一个[Symbol.iterator]属性指向该对象的默认迭代器方法。

![Array.from(arr)与[...arr]究竟有何本质区别?](/imgrand/a2ROF91Q.webp)